以前我们都是用JS来实现字母的首字母大小写的,但现在没有必要了,CSS完全可以实现,话说兼容性还好从IE6开始就支持了。

text-transform:none | capitalize | uppercase | lowercase

none:

无转换

capitalize:

将每个单词的第一个字母转换成大写

用CSS text-transform转换字母大小写

<style>
  #box{
    text-transform:capitalize;
  }
</style>
<div >css javascript html5</div>
uppercase:

将每个单词转换成大写

用CSS text-transform转换字母大小写

#box{
  text-transform:uppercase;
}
<div >css javascript html5</div>
lowercase:

将每个单词转换成小写
用CSS text-transform转换字母大小写

#box{
  text-transform:lowercase;
}
<div >CSS JAVASCRIPT HTML5</div>

实在是太简单了,都不好多说什么。

相关文章:

  • 2022-12-23
  • 2021-11-06
  • 2022-02-02
  • 2022-12-23
  • 2022-02-12
  • 2022-01-13
  • 2022-01-01
猜你喜欢
  • 2021-11-19
  • 2022-12-23
  • 2022-12-23
  • 2021-06-19
  • 2022-12-23
  • 2022-12-23
相关资源
相似解决方案